Gambling Slots are some of the most popular games in casinos. They offer players a chance to win huge jackpots for small wagers. They are also fun to play and require little skill. The games are available in a variety of styles and themes, so there is sure to be one that is right for every player. However, it is important to know how these games work before you begin playing them.

A gambling slot machine is a device that takes coins or paper tickets with barcodes and uses an electro-mechanical random number generator to determine a winning combination of symbols. The reels spin and when a winning combination is achieved, the game will display the amount won. These machines can be found in many casinos, arcades and amusement parks. Some of them have progressive jackpots, while others have a fixed maximum payout amount. The odds of hitting a jackpot on a slot machine are usually very low, but there is always the possibility of a big win.

The most popular slot machines are three-reel games with a single pay line, but some have as many as 100 lines of various shapes and patterns. These slots are designed to be more visually appealing and can provide players with a more varied experience than traditional slots.

Another way to increase your chances of winning is to look for machines that have high RTPs (return to player percentages). These machines are designed to return more of the money you wager to the player. A machine with a high RTP will have higher odds of hitting the jackpot than a machine with lower odds.

When you’re playing a slot, you should check the paytable to see what symbols are needed to hit the jackpot and how much each symbol is worth. Then, place your bets accordingly. You can find the paytable through a ’help’ or ‘i’ button on the machine’s touch screen or by asking a slot attendant.
